muy apreciado
A phrase is a group of words commonly used together (e.g., once upon a time).
phrase
a. my dear
Muy apreciado Eduardo: Espero que al recibo de esta carta te encuentres bien.My dear Eduardo, I hope that upon receipt of this letter all is well with you.
a. greatly appreciated
Cualquier donativo, por pequeño que sea, será muy apreciado.Any donation, however small, will be greatly appreciated.
b. highly appreciated
Este ejemplar es muy apreciado entre los coleccionistas de sellos.This item is highly esteemed among stamp collectors.
c. much appreciated
Gracias, Clara. Tu esfuerzo es muy apreciado por todos en la escuela.Thank you, Clara. Your hard work is much appreciated by everyone in the school.
